What is a No Deposit Bonus?

A no deposit bonus is a promotional offer provided by brokers to attract new traders. It allows individuals to trade without risking their own funds initially.

How to Claim the Instaforex No Deposit Bonus

To claim the bonus, you typically need to register an account with Instaforex and complete the necessary verification steps. Ensure you follow all instructions provided by the broker.

Terms and Conditions

Bonuses come with specific terms and conditions, including trading volume requirements and limitations on withdrawal options. It is crucial to read and understand these terms before using the bonus.

Benefits of Using a No Deposit Bonus

Using a no deposit bonus allows you to explore the trading platform and test your strategies without financial risk. It provides a risk-free environment to gain experience in the financial markets.

Risks Involved

While no deposit bonuses offer many advantages, trading on financial markets always involves the risk of losing capital. It is important to trade responsibly and be aware of the market volatility.
